In a combination of a horror game and light-gun game, Resident Evil: Dead Aim puts you on a cruise ship infested with zombies. The events of Biohazard Heroes Never Die / Resident Evil Dead Aim, take place in the latter part of 2002, with the Umbrella Corporation on its financial knees. Resident Evil: Dead Aim for the PS2 (below) is a new departure for the franchise a third-person zombie hunt combined with first-person shooter action using G-Con 2 compatible light guns.
